BPS charge Hamilton woman with Break and Enter

Brantford Police ServiceBPS charge Hamilton woman with Break and Enter

Officers with the Brantford Police Service were dispatched to a Nelson Street residence for a report of a break and enter in progress at approximately 9:45 a.m. on Wednesday, September 28, 2022.

Officers attended and located the accused sleeping on the floor of the residence. The accused was taken into custody without incident.

A search incident to arrest found the accused in possession of a replica pistol, and a switch blade knife. 

Investigation revealed the accused is currently in violation of valid peace bonds.

As a result, a 24-year-old female from Hamilton, stands charged with the following Criminal Code offences: 

• Break and Enter with Intent

• Breach Peace Bond x 2 

• Possess Prohibited Weapon 

The accused was held for bail.
